Divine geography exists. God has meticulously designed specific locations for your flourishing, reservoirs of His favor, gateways of opportunity, and storehouses of provision. Your destiny is intricately woven with these ordained places.
As Deuteronomy 28:2-3 proclaims, ‘And all these blessings shall come upon you and overtake you, because you obey the voice of the LORD your God. Blessed shall you be in the city, and blessed shall you be in the country.’
This is not merely a poetic sentiment but a tangible promise. Faith and a positive disposition are vital, yet they are incomplete without divine placement. To experience the fullness of God’s intended blessings, we must cultivate a keen sensitivity to His guiding voice, the gentle whisper that directs us to our designated places of abundance.
This means that God’s orchestration of our lives extends beyond dramatic pronouncements; He shapes our paths through the subtle nuances of everyday circumstances. He may call us to persevere in uncomfortable environments, where trials test our resolve and the temptation to flee is strong.
Or, He might lead us through unfair situations, where righteousness seems to be met with adversity. Conversely, closed doors, often perceived as setbacks, can be divine redirections, propelling us towards greater realms of advancement.
Resist the urge to contest these closed doors or succumb to discouragement when pushed beyond your comfort zone. Embrace the transformative power of change, recognizing that God’s shifts are always purposeful, leading you toward an elevated plane of blessing.
